2025-06-27arm: io.h: Fix io accessors for KVMIlias Apalodimas
commit 2e2c2a5e72a8 ("arm: qemu: override flash accessors to use virtualizable instructions") explains why we can't have instructions with multiple output registers when running under QEMU + KVM and the instruction leads to an exception to the hypervisor. USB XHCI is such a case (MMIO) where a ldr w1, [x0], #4 is emitted for xhci_start() which works fine with QEMU but crashes for QEMU + KVM. These instructions cannot be emulated by KVM as they do not produce syndrome information data that KVM can use to infer the destination register, the faulting address, whether it was a load or store, or if it's a 32 or 64 bit general-purpose register. There are two problems making this the default. - It will emit ldr + add or str + add instead of ldr/str(post increment) in somne cases - Some platforms that depend on TPL/SPL grow in size enough so that the binary doesn't fit anymore. So let's add proper I/O accessors add a Kconfig option to turn it off by default apart from our QEMU builds. 2021-07-28arm64: Update memcpy_{from, to}io() helpersPatrice Chotard
At early U-Boot stage, before relocation, MMU is not yet configured and disabled. DDR may not be configured with the correct memory attributes (can be configured in MT_DEVICE instead of MT_MEMORY). In this case, usage of memcpy_{from, to}io() may leads to synchronous abort in AARCH64 in case the normal memory address is not 64Bits aligned. To avoid such situation, forbid usage of normal memory cast to (u64 *) in case MMU is not enabled. 2016-08-05ARM: Rework and correct barrier definitionsTom Rini
As part of testing booting Linux kernels on Rockchip devices, it was discovered by Ziyuan Xu and Sandy Patterson that we had multiple and for some cases incomplete isb definitions. This was causing a failure to boot of the Linux kernel. In order to solve this problem as well as cover any corner cases that we may also have had a number of changes are made in order to consolidate things. First, <asm/barriers.h> now becomes the source of isb/dsb/dmb definitions. This however introduces another complexity. Due to needing to build SPL for 32bit tegra with -march=armv4 we need to borrow the __LINUX_ARM_ARCH__ logic from the Linux Kernel in a more complete form. Move this from arch/arm/lib/Makefile to arch/arm/Makefile and add a comment about it. Now that we can always know what the target CPU is capable off we can get always do the correct thing for the barrier. The final part of this is that need to be consistent everywhere and call isb()/dsb()/dmb() and NOT call ISB/DSB/DMB in some cases and the function names in others. 2011-02-21ARM: fix write*() I/O accessorsWolfgang Denk
Commit 3c0659b "ARM: Avoid compiler optimization for readb, writeb and friends." introduced I/O accessors with memory barriers. Unfortunately the new write*() accessors introduced a bug: The problem is that the argument "v" gets evaluated twice. This breaks code like used here (from "drivers/net/dnet.c"): for (i = 0; i < wrsz; i++) writel(*bufp++, &dnet->regs->TX_DATA_FIFO); Use auxiliary variables to avoid such problems. 2011-02-02ARM: Avoid compiler optimization for readb, writeb and friends.Alexander Holler
gcc 4.5.1 seems to ignore (at least some) volatile definitions, avoid that as done in the kernel. Reading C99 6.7.3 8 and the comment 114) there, I think it is a bug of that gcc version to ignore the volatile type qualifier used e.g. in __arch_getl(). Anyway, using a definition as in the kernel headers avoids such optimizations when gcc 4.5.1 is used. Maybe the headers as used in the current linux-kernel should be used, but to avoid large changes, I've just added a small change to the current headers.
